0488673118 2008-08-20 Production Wells Violations Noted An inspection revealed contamination and pollution. Fluid was observed inside the dike. A Quantab placed in this fluid exceeded 10 units. Bare areas were observed in two locations, in close proximity to each other, and found to extend over an embankment. Measurements of these areas were 62 x 8 and 53 x 4. Contamination and pollution was also observed on the ground surface around the bottom of old tank (not in use) and parted steel line located, in front of tank. The line appears to have been abandoned. After observing the path of both locations, the source appears to be from the earthen dike/and or drain. Mr. Mike Johnson was contacted by tleephone and informed of the inspection results.

1945272146 2013-01-07 Production Wells Violations Noted There is no identification posted on the well head or the tank battery. Well is in production. There are two plastic tanks on site that are not being used and are damaged beyond repair. Vegetation is sparse on the site. A phone call was placed on 01/09/13 at 8:44 am to Mr. Mike Johnson about these issues. I left a voicemail. I told him that he should remove the tanks when the site dries up and attempt to establish vegetation in the spring. I also told him that identification must be posted at the well head or tank battery as soon as possible.
